Formations et diplomes

publicité
Bilel RAHMANI
Ingénieur Analyse et Développement
Java / JEE
10 mois d'expérience
Télé : 53 199 586
Email : [email protected]
FORMATIONS ET DIPLOMES
12/2014
Formation en Développement Personnel ;
2014
Diplôme national d'ingénieur en informatique ;
Spécialité : Génie du Logiciel et des Systèmes d’Information ;
Mention : Bien ;
Institution : Institut Supérieur d'Informatique, Université Tunis El Manar.
2011
Licence Appliquée en informatique ;
Spécialité : Systèmes Informatique et Logiciels ;
Mention : Bien ;
Institution : Institut Supérieur d'Informatique, Université Tunis El Manar.
2008
Baccalauréat en Science de l’Informatique avec mention Bien.
CERTIFICATIONS
2015
ORACLE Certified Associate Java Programmer 7
LANGUES
Anglais
Lu, écrit
Français
Lu, écrit et parlé
COMPETENCES TECHNIQUES
Technologies de programmation
Java, JEE, Android, C, C++, VB.Net, VB6, C#, SQL, SQL3, PL/SQL,
PHP, XML, CSS, JavaScript, PHP.
Framework de développement
Spring, Spring Security, Spring Web Flow, EJB, Hibernate, JPA,
JSF2, Primefaces, Swing, Axis 2, REST, Play Framework 2, EJB2,
EJB3, LOG4J, Quartz Framework,...
OS de programmation
Android
IDE
Eclipse, Netbeans, Visual Studio
Base des données
Oracle 10g,
PostgreSQL
Reporting
IReport 5.6.0, itext 5.3.4
Méthode d’Analyse
Merise
Langage de Modélisation
UML 2
SQL
Server
2005,
Microsoft
Access,
MySQL,
Page 1 sur 4
Serveurs
Apache Tomcat, GlassFish, Jboss
Outils
Maven 3, Talend Open Studio for Data Integration
OS
Windows, Ubuntu, Windows Server 2003
Gestion de projet
MS Project, IceScrum, Mindview
Outils de modélisation
Power AMC
EXPERIENCES PROFESSIONNELLES
Cynapsys (Janvier 2015 - Octobre 2015)
Ingénieur Analyse et Développement Java/JEE
Projet 1 : Système d’information qui permet la gestion des groupes d’assurance.
Tâches réalisées :
 Développement des modules (Gestion des contrats, Gestion des agences, Gestions des
assurés, Gestion des profils, Gestion des utilisateurs, Gestion des fonctionnalités...) ;
 Gestion de la base de données ;
 Traitement des états (Reporting) ;
 Développement des Jobs ;
 Mise en place des règles de sécurité de l'application.
Equipe-projet : un chef de projet, 5 ingénieurs d’Etude et un testeur.
Outils et environnement :
 Langages : Java 8 ;
 Base de données : PostgreSQL ;
 Serveurs d’application : Tomcat 8 ;
 Frameworks et technologies : Hibernate, Spring , Spring security, Primefaces 4, JSF 2.2,
Quartz,
 IDE: PowerAmc (conception), SqlDeveloper, IReport 5.6.0, JBOSS Tools, Spring Tools Suite
Projet 2 : Développement, mise en place et maintenance d’une application informatique relative à la
gestion du colisée et de la nationale.
Description du projet : Le système doit assurer la gérance des biens : gestion des locaux, gestion des
locataires, gestion des contrats et des loyers, gestion du contentieux, gestion des quittances et la
gestion des recettes, ainsi que la maintenance des locaux qui se décompose des fonctionnalités
suivante : la prise en charge des réclamations, la gestion des tiers, la gestion des réparations, le
règlement des tiers et la répartition des charges. D’autre part le système doit fournir des statistiques,
des tableaux de bord et des états de sorties. Sachant que ce système sera interfacé avec les
applications existantes de la SNIT (Système comptable, Système de contrôle…).
Les tâches accomplies :
 Développement des tous les modules du projet ;
 Développement des Jobs ;
 Mise en place des règles de sécurité de l'application.
Equipe-projet : Chef de projet, un ingénieur analyse, un ingénieur développement et un testeur.
Outils et environnement :
 Langages : Java 8 ;
Page 2 sur 4




Base de données : Oracle 10g ;
Serveurs d’application : Tomcat 8 ;
Frameworks et technologies : Hibernate, Spring , Spring security, Primefaces 4, JSF 2.2,
Quartz,
IDE: PowerAmc (conception), SqlDeveloper, IReport 5.6.0, JBOSS Tools, Spring Tools
Suite.
STAGES
Société Tunisienne d'Informatique pour l'Ingénierie
Projet de Fin d’Etudes
2014
Projet : Mise en place d’une solution GED Web et Mobile.
Description du projet : Conception et mise en place d'un système de gestion électronique des
documents (GED) web et mobile (Android) qui assure les fonctionnalités suivante :
 Stockage des documents ;
 Recherche des documents ;
 Indexation et archivage des documents ;
 Gestion des emails ;
 Partage des documents.
Les tâches accomplies :
 Conception et Développement des modules web et Android ;
 Test ;
 Recette fonctionnelle.
Equipe-projet : un chef de projet et un ingénieur d'études et développement.
Outils et environnement :
 Langages : Java 7 ;
 Base de données : PostgreSQL ;
 Serveurs d’application : Tomcat 7 ;
 Frameworks et technologies : Anroid, Hibernate, Spring , Spring security, Primefaces 4,
JSF 2.2, Quartz, Open CMIS, Alfresco 4.
 Outils : PowerAmc ,IReport 5.6.0, eclipse.
Société Tunisienne d'Informatique pour l'Ingénierie
Stage
2013
Projet : Réalisation d'une plateforme E-Learning
Outils et Technologies : Java/JEE, Spring, JSF2, Primefaces, Hibernate, Maven, itext
Projets Académiques (2012)
Mini projet de Net-Trading ;
Technologies: Java/JEE, Spring, JSF2, Primefaces, Hibernate, Swing, itext.
Page 3 sur 4
Mini projet GPAO ;
Technologies : Java, Hibernate/JPA, Swing, itext.
Réalisation d'un outil de modélisation du réseau de Petri ;
Technologie : Java, EMF, GMF.
Entreprise GHARBI JALEL
Stage de fin d’études
2011
Projet : Conception et Implémentation d'un Outil du Travail Collaboratif.
Outils et Technologies : Java, JSP, Hibernate.
Entreprise GHARBI JALEL
Stage
2010
Projet : Développement d’un Système de Gestion de Stock.
Outils et Technologies : Framework .Net, C#, SQL server 2005.
Page 4 sur 4
Téléchargement